Excellent filling for cheesecakes: 5 best recipes
With chocolate
Required ingredients:
- 400 g cottage cheese
- 1 egg
- 3 tbsp. l. semolina
- 4 tbsp. l. wheat flour
- 1 chocolate bar
- sunflower oil for frying
Cooking method:
- In a large container, combine the cottage cheese with the egg. Add salt and sugar. Add wheat flour and semolina. Mix everything well until smooth.
- Dust your palm with flour and form the curd mixture into balls.
- Make a small depression in the center of each piece. Place a piece of chocolate in it. Wrap it in dough, forming a cheesecake. Roll the workpiece in wheat flour.
- In a frying pan with butter, fry the curds until golden brown on both sides, setting the heat to medium. Cheesecakes with warm chocolate inside are ready!
With banana
Required ingredients:
- 200 g cottage cheese
- 1 banana
- 1 tbsp. l. Sahara
- 4 tbsp. l. wheat flour
- 1 egg
- 2 tbsp. l. sunflower oil
Cooking method:
- In a deep bowl, combine cottage cheese with egg and sugar. Mash everything thoroughly with a fork. Add 3 tbsp. l. sifted wheat flour. Mix thoroughly.
- Peel the banana. Cut it into small pucks.
- Roll the curd dough into balls. Make them into flatbreads. Then place a banana slice in the center of each piece. Form the cheesecakes with floured hands.
- In a heated frying pan with oil, fry the pieces on each side, setting the heat to moderate. Bon appetit!
With condensed milk
Required ingredients:
- 320 g cottage cheese
- 1 egg
- 120 g wheat flour
- 6 tsp. boiled condensed milk
- 1 chip salt
- 1 tbsp. l. Sahara
- sunflower oil for frying
Cooking method:
- Combine cottage cheese with egg and sugar in a deep container. Mash everything with a fork. Add 90 g of wheat flour and salt. Mix the ingredients until smooth.
- Roll the curd mass into a sausage. Using a knife, divide it into 6 equal pieces. Form each piece of dough into a ball. Make them into flatbreads.
- Place 1 tsp on the center of each piece. boiled condensed milk. Seal the edges and then form the cheesecakes. Roll them in wheat flour. Shake off excess.
- Fry the cheesecakes on both sides in a frying pan with sunflower oil until golden brown. Ready!
With apple
Required ingredients:
- 200 g cottage cheese
- 1 egg
- 3 tbsp. l. Sahara
- 5 tbsp. l. wheat flour
- 2 wood chips soda
- 2 medium apples
- ground cinnamon to taste
- 1 tbsp. l. butter
- 1 handful of raisins
- sunflower oil for frying
Cooking method:
- Peel the apples. Remove the cores. Cut the fruit into small cubes. Heat a frying pan with butter. Add apples, cinnamon and 1 tbsp. l. Sahara. Simmer the fruit until soft.
- Mash the cottage cheese with a fork. In a separate bowl, combine the egg with 2 tbsp. l. Sahara. Whip them up. Add the egg mixture to the cottage cheese. Add baking soda. Mix everything carefully.
- Add wheat flour to the curd mass. Mix well. Form curd balls from the resulting mass, turning each of them into a flat cake.
- Place the apple filling and some raisins in the center of the dough. Pinch the edges. Give the blanks the shape of classic cheesecakes.
- In a frying pan with butter, fry the curds over low heat until golden on each side (under the lid). Serve them for tea!
With jam
Required ingredients:
- 250 g cottage cheese
- 1 egg
- 1 chip salt
- 2 tbsp. l. wheat flour
- 2 tbsp. l. Sahara
- berry jam to taste
- sunflower oil for frying
Cooking method:
- In a deep container, combine cottage cheese with egg and sugar. Grind everything with a fork until smooth. Add sifted wheat flour and salt. Stir until smooth.
- Form the curd dough into small balls. Then make them into flat cakes. Place some berry jam in the center of each circle. Form cheesecakes.
- In a frying pan with butter, fry the pieces filled with berry jam until golden. Enjoy your tea!
